4 Before LS1 More than 3 years of successful operation of LHC and its vacuum system Insulation vacuum during LHC operation: Very good performance No shutdown or beam stop due to any problem coming from IV 9 April 2014 Jaime Perez Espinos 4
5 Introduction to LS1 LS1: ~ 2 years stop beam to beam Objective: Bring all necessary equipment up to the level needed for 7TeV/beam Main priorities of LS1 for LHC: Activities linked to incident Sept. 2008: Consolidation of 13 ka supeconducting splices and repair of defectuous interconnects (powering at 7 TeV) Installation of remaining pressure relief devices DN200 Repair of known He leaks (especially 2 in sectors 3-4 and 4-5) Others (related to IV): IV and cold BV consolidation Maintenance 9 April 2014 Jaime Perez Espinos 5

11 LS1: summary of main activities so far Consolidation activities: IV: ~3,800 mechanical interventions Cold BV: ~1,000 mechanical interventions Inspections (bellows, flexibles ): ~15,000 Maintenance: IV: ~300 vacuum pumps (130 turbos) Leak tests: Support clamshell leak tests: ~5,600 Global leak tests: Envelope: ~330 Internal (He lines): ~230 9 April 2014 Jaime Perez Espinos 11
12 Leaks follow-up in IV MAGNET + QRL More demanding for acceptance LS1 leaks identified before start of consolidation activities, so not linked to them Remaining leaks = leaks open for actions or leaks repaired but not leak tested goal: no leaks at start of operation Acceptable leak levels during LS1 more demanding than during installation phase All leaks correspond to IV. No leaks present in cold BV 9 April 2014 Jaime Perez Espinos 12

16 Known leak: s. 4-5 QRL, lines C & D (internal leak) Virtual leak SOLVED! Failure process: filling of the inter-layer space with time (3-4 years of operation) Pressure increase of the inter-layer space during warm-up leading to the compensator collapse Compensator damaged: DN100 multiply (4 plies of 0.3 mm) 9 April 2014 Jaime Perez Espinos 16

20 Summary Consolidation activites are ongoing and with good timing Quality of final product has improved and leaks decreased Right leak test methodology has led to identification of all leaks; many of them already solved LS1 is allowing to deepen, even more, in machine knowledge and leak types 9 April 2014 Jaime Perez Espinos 20
